Por padrão, todos os layouts de componentes e seções estão disponíveis para as pessoas que desenvolvem um site. Pode haver ocasiões em que você queira ocultar um layout de componente ou seção, para que fique indisponível ao usar um tema específico. Por exemplo, se você quiser promover uma aparência consistente que não use componentes de botão ou layouts de seção deslizante, poderá ocultá-los em um tema editando o arquivo components.json do tema.
Para ocultar componentes e layouts de seção em um tema:
hidden
como true
.
"type":"scs-button", "id":"scs-button", "hidden":true
"type":"scs-sectionlayout", "id":"scs-sl-slider", "hidden":true
A entrada completa no arquivo components.json para ocultar o componente do botão e o layout da seção deslizante seria a seguinte:
[ { "name":"", "list":[ { "type":"scs-button", "id":"scs-button", "hidden":true }, { "type":"scs-sectionlayout", "id":"scs-sl-slider", "hidden":true } ] }, { "name": "Starter", "list": [ { "type": "component", "id": "StarterComponent", "themed": true }, { "type": "component", "id": "StarterFooter", "themed": true } ] } ]